PROJECTmagazine ran an article entitled “How to make time for happiness” that offers suggestions for just that. It is quite easy to get wrapped up in obligations and responsibilities but having “down time” is critical for a happy life, even if you have to schedule it to make sure it happens (and the article even provides a scheduling tool).
Whether it’s saving an hour a day to spend with loved ones or veg in front of the TV, it’s important to slow down and enjoy yourself a little bit each day. This is the best way to avoid burn-out and to enhance your quality of life.
